Signs Your AC Needs Fixing?
When homeowners observe unusual fluctuations in their indoor temperature, it often signals that their air conditioning system might need repair. Additional indicators include strange noises, such as grinding or hissing, which can suggest mechanical problems or refrigerant leaks. Moreover, pooling water around the unit may point to a obstructed drain line or a refrigerant leak, both requiring immediate attention. Homeowners should also be alert for unusual odors coming from the AC, as these may signify mold growth or electrical issues. If the system frequently cycles on and off, it could be a sign of an malfunctioning thermostat or other underlying problems. Lastly, a noticeable increase in energy bills without a change in usage patterns can point to a faulty unit. Recognizing these signs early can prevent more extensive damage and ensure the air conditioning system runs efficiently.

Insufficient Air Flow Troubles
Weak airflow complications can greatly impact an air conditioning system's efficiency and comfort. These problems frequently come from clogged air filters, which restrict airflow and compel the system to work harder. Also, blocked ducts or vents can impede cool air from circulating adequately across the home. Yet another potential cause is a malfunctioning blower motor, which may fail to push air correctly. Homeowners must regularly inspect and replace filters, ensuring ducts are clear of obstructions. Overlooking low airflow can generate increased energy costs and can strain the system, generating more severe issues down the line. Addressing these matters promptly helps copyright peak performance and lengthens the lifespan of the air conditioning unit.
Unusual Sounds Coming Forth
Strange sounds from an air conditioning unit can indicate underlying issues that need immediate attention. Common sounds such as scraping, whistling, or clattering often indicate mechanical problems. A grinding noise may suggest worn bearings or a malfunctioning motor. Hissing can point to refrigerant leaks, which compromise efficiency and can lead to costly repairs. Rattling noises often arise from loose components or debris within the unit. These sounds should not be ignored, as they may develop into more serious issues if left unaddressed. Regular maintenance and prompt diagnosis by a professional technician can help prevent these problems, ensuring the air conditioning system operates smoothly throughout the summer months. Homeowners are encouraged to monitor these noises closely for peak performance.
Essential Maintenance Guidelines to Boost Your AC Operation
Preserving optimal air conditioning operation requires a few key methods. Regularly cleaning or replacing air filters is important, as clogged filters restrict airflow and reduce efficiency. Homeowners should check filters monthly and change them every one to three months, depending on usage. find the information Keeping the outdoor unit clear of debris, such as leaves and dirt, also enhances airflow, allowing the system to function optimally.
In addition, scheduling routine expert care can discover looming difficulties before they intensify. Technicians can maintain coils, measure coolant quantities, and ensure all components are performing correctly. Homeowners should also consider sealing air ducts to prevent air loss, which can lead to wasted power. Finally, adjusting the thermostat to a steady temperature can ease strain on the system. By following these essential maintenance recommendations, homeowners can increase system efficiency and deliver a refreshing, comfortable space during the summer months.

DIY Air Conditioning Diagnostic Tips
Recognizing AC problems can empower homeowners to tackle minor issues before they deteriorate. One of the first steps is to check the thermostat settings; making sure it's set to "cool" and the desired temperature is right can resolve many issues. Homeowners should also inspect the air filter, as a dirty filter can limit airflow and strain the system. Cleaning or replacing the filter regularly is essential for peak performance.
Next, inspecting the external component for debris or obstructions is essential. Removing leaves, dirt, and other materials can boost air circulation and performance. Additionally, assessing for ice buildup on the cooling coils can signal a refrigerant issue or airflow obstruction.
Finally, listening for strange noises during operation may suggest mechanical issues. By adhering to these simple diagnostic guidelines, homeowners can often pinpoint and fix minor AC problems, guaranteeing their home remains cool throughout the summer months.
When should you employ a professional for AC repair?
When confronted with ongoing air conditioning problems, how can property owners decide when it's time to call in a professional? A few key signs can guide this choice. First, if the unit is producing warm air despite being set to cool, it may indicate a refrigerant leak or compressor issue. Additionally, strange noises, such as grinding or screeching, often indicate mechanical failures that require expert attention.
Regular cycling, where the unit turns on and off constantly, can also reveal underlying problems that could get worse over time. Homeowners should be aware of climbing electricity expenses, as inefficiencies often arise from malfunctioning components.
Finally, if the system is aged beyond 10 years and calls for multiple repairs, it may be more cost-effective to reach out to a technician for a comprehensive review. Spotting these signals can help confirm that the air conditioning system operates efficiently throughout the summer months.
Variables Impacting Air Conditioning Service Expenses
Recognizing the necessity for competent AC repair is just the beginning; understanding the factors that control repair expenditures is equally important. Several elements can considerably affect the final cost. First, the type of repair needed plays a crucial role; minor remedies typically cost less than major piece switches. The duration and brand of the air conditioning unit also apply, as older models may necessitate specialized parts that are harder to find and more expensive.
Labor prices vary depending on the location and service provider, with some technicians requesting increased fees due to their proficiency or demand. Moreover, the time of year can affect pricing, as repairs might be more costly during peak summer months when demand peaks. Lastly, extra services, including routine maintenance or diagnostic fees, may contribute to the total expense. Being aware of these considerations helps homeowners make wise choices when seeking AC repair services.

How Often Should I Coordinate Professional AC Servicing?
Experts advise scheduling your air conditioning maintenance at least once a year, preferably before the warm season begins. Routine inspections can stop failures, boost efficiency, and prolong the lifespan of the air conditioning unit.
May I Operate My AC When the Power Goes Out?
In the event of a loss of power, AC systems cannot run, as they depend on electricity to function. Still, some homeowners could employ backup generators to power their systems for a limited time, maintaining comfort until electricity returns. Essential precautions must be observed when proceeding.
What Are the Advantages of Upgrading My AC System?
Upgrading an AC unit enhances power consumption, reduces utility bills, improves air purity, boosts comfort, and often offers advanced features such as intelligent management. These advantages contribute to a more eco-friendly and pleasant living environment.
What Ways Can I Boost Indoor Air Quality Using My AC?
Optimizing indoor air quality with an AC system involves regular filter changes, ensuring proper ventilation, using air purifiers, and maintaining ideal humidity levels. These steps help decrease allergens and pollutants, promoting a healthier indoor environment.
What energy-efficient AC choices are accessible for my home?
Various power-conscious air conditioning choices are offered, including inverter systems, ductless mini-splits, and ENERGY STAR-rated units. These options reduce energy consumption while maintaining comfort, ultimately generating lower utility bills and a lighter environmental footprint.
